Bubyeokjeong Pyeongyang Mandu is a Pyeongyang-style dumpling restaurant in Paju Book City, Gyeonggi. Having first eaten here while pregnant, the writer came back with her husband and their 100-day-old baby for bibim makguksu (spicy buckwheat noodles), nokdu bindaetteok (mung bean pancake) and 1++ hanwoo jjabagi (Korean beef stew) at 14,000 won, and the baby chairs and free misutgaru (roasted grain drink) made eating with an infant easy. Bubyeokjeong suits families who want a light, clean Korean meal after shopping at Paju Lotte Outlet.
